The main difference between precision and standard camshafts is the degree of accuracy. Precision camshafts are designed to be more accurate and consistent, which helps to improve the performance of the engine. The camshafts are designed to be more precise, which allows them to open and close the valves more quickly and accurately. This helps to improve the performance of the engine by allowing it to generate more power and torque.

In addition, precision camshafts are designed to be more durable. The increased accuracy of the camshafts means that they are less likely to suffer from wear and tear over time. This can help to increase the lifespan of the engine, as well as reducing the amount of maintenance and repair costs that you have to pay.

It is also important to understand the mechanics of how precision camshafts work. The camshafts are designed to rotate in order to open and close the valves. When the camshafts rotate, they cause the valves to open and close at specific intervals. This allows the engine to provide a consistent flow of air and fuel into the engine, which helps to ensure that the engine runs smoothly and efficiently.
